    What is Pong games?

    Pong games are a category of classic arcade-style games that originated with the 1972 release of Pong by Atari. This groundbreaking title was one of the first commercially successful video games. Pong is a simple yet addictive game that simulates a tennis-like experience where players hit a ball back and forth on a basic, minimalist screen.

    The game features:
    • Two-player mode: Players compete against each other, making it a pioneer in multiplayer gaming.
    • Basic controls: Players use buttons or paddles to move their on-screen paddles up and down to hit the ball.
    • Simplicity: The game is known for its straightforward design, with black and white graphics and minimalistic gameplay.
    • Competitive nature: The goal is to outscore your opponent by making the ball land on their side of the screen.

    Pong has inspired countless variations and remakes, but its core concept remains unchanged. It is celebrated as a foundational game in the history of video games.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    What is the objective of Pong?
    The objective of Pong is to hit the ball past your opponent's paddle, scoring points when they fail to return it.

    Can Pong be played solo?
    Pong was primarily designed for two players, but some versions include a single-player mode where you play against AI.

    How do the controls work in Pong?
    Players use buttons or paddles to move their on-screen paddles up and down, attempting to make contact with the ball to keep it in play.
